Savannah Ghost Pirates & City of Savannah Announce Public Skating Dates at Enmarket Arena • Savannah Herald

SAVANNAH — The Savannah Ghost Pirates, in partnership with the City of Savannah, are inviting the community to lace up their skates and hit the ice during upcoming public skating sessions at Enmarket Arena. Whether you’re a seasoned skater or just finding your balance, these sessions offer a fun, family-friendly way to enjoy the ice in a world-class arena — no slapshots required.

Public skating dates and times include:

  • January 14: 8:15–9:45 p.m.
  • January 15: 5:30–7:00 p.m. and 7:15–8:45 p.m.
  • January 28: 5:30–7:00 p.m. and 7:15–8:45 p.m.
  • January 29: 5:30–7:00 p.m. and 7:15–8:45 p.m.

Admission is $20 for adults and $15 for children (12 and under), with skate rental included, so all you need to bring is your sense of adventure. Guests are welcome to bring their own skates if they prefer. Please note that sticks and pucks are not permitted during public skating sessions.

From first-time wobblers to confident gliders, everyone is welcome on the ice. It’s a great way to stay active, make memories, and experience Enmarket Arena from a whole new perspective.
